Why undo is rated Medium

While the tool is described as a 'safety net,' it reverses write operations (like the sibling tools that add objects and components) but does not permanently delete or destroy data. Undo is a reversible modification operation, making it Write rather than Destructive.

From the tool's definition Tool name 'undo' and description 'Undo the last editor action' indicates it reverses/modifies the state of game editor operations rather than irreversibly destroying data.

Can I rate-limit undo? +

Yes. Add a rate_limit block to the undo rule in your PolicyLayer policy. For example, setting max: 10 and window: 60 limits the tool to 10 calls per minute. Rate limits are tracked per agent session and reset automatically.

How do I block undo completely? +

Set action: deny in the PolicyLayer policy for undo. The AI agent will receive a policy violation error and cannot call the tool. You can also include a reason field to explain why the tool is blocked.
